Hi All
Win 7 PC (HP DV6 12Gb RM, 256GB Samsung EVO SSD Boot drive, all latest windows updates)
- All working fine then the keyboard stopped working (press keys, computer does not respond. Mouse OK, - USB keyboard OK) so I rebooted and it would not reboot. Sorry cant remember error code but required startup repair
- Used Macrium recovery disk to repair and it booted fine
- 2 weeks later the same problem occurred. Again start up repair fixed it.

Now I am starting to worry. I would suspect DSS problems but HD Sentinel reports SSD health as excellent (89%) expected lifetime 1000+


Event Viewer reports instances of each of

08:36 Session "RtcPalVideoEtwSession" failed to start with the following error: 0xC0000022 (and another earlier at 8:24)

8:41 Session "ReadyBoot" stopped due to the following error: 0xC0000188
8:41 Session "Microsoft Security Client OOBE" stopped due to the following error: 0xC000000D

8:41 Event filter with query "SELECT * FROM __InstanceModificationEvent WITHIN 60 WHERE TargetInstance ISA "Win32_Processor" AND TargetInstance.LoadPercentage > 99" could not be reactivated in namespace "//./root/CIMV2" because of error 0x80041003. Events cannot be delivered through this filter until the problem is corrected.

If you're using MSE, go here-

C:\ProgramData\Microsoft\Microsoft Security Client\Support\EppOobe.etl

and delete the file.

Reboot.

I don't know if that has anything to do with your keyboard not working.

Thanks.
I switched off MSE; deleted the file and the reboot failure has not (yet!) recurred.
Keyboard no problems either (but this may be coincidence)


I notice the file came back within 10 minutes so presumably the assumption was it had got corrupted? I have not yet switched MSE back on so I'll try that tonight


What does this file do?

Does it damage MSE functionality?

How on earth can MS write software that screws up the boot process and why haven't they fixed it?


If it doesn't happen again this week I'll consider it solved

I don't know exactly what it is generated by but it is a log file (ETL File Extension - What is an .etl file and how do I open it?). It's associated with Oobe (Out Of The Box Experience). Since it's associated with Microsoft security, I would assume that it's logging some unwanted event. Why it has the effects that you had is beyond me.

Please schedule a disk check.
Open a CMD window as administrator and type:
chkdsk c: /f
It will say that the drive is in use and ask if you what to schedule to next start = Yes
Reboot.
